    To Amanda F. : What do you mean when you say that when you upgrade at guest services to a premier annual pass that they can calculate the upgrade price based on upgrading from a package as opposed to paying face value? Do they just Calculate the dif u paid

    Hi Tonia,

    If your upgrading to the Premier Passport from a Magic Your Way Ticket Package, you will receive credit for the "package price" value of the tickets, which is usually lower than the outright, full price...Then they calculate the difference between the value of your tickets and the price of the Premier Pass.  

    In other words, when you purchase a vacation package, the tickets are discounted along with the room rate to reflect a package price that works out to be lower than if you had purchased everything "a la carte."  Guest relations will determine that discounted rate, and then credit you that determined amount before calculating the difference!
